The Ideal Color 35 is a chunky compact viewfinder camera made in West Germany, France and Spain in the 1950s. It has a 35/3.5 Nixon lens (made in France), apertures from f/3.5 to f/16, shutter speeds of 1/25, 1/50 and 1/100 (plus B). It has a very long, thing shutter release button on the top of the camera which pops up when the camera is ready to shoot. Has a removable bottom to load film into the spool like the Barnack Leicas.
